Transaction 71578aaf90af8b4e17e115a943ff0e390a29d076da201cffd03b68d3e021fc41

1 Input
2 Outputs
  • 71578aaf90af8b4e17e115a943ff0e390a29d076da201cffd03b68d3e021fc41:0
  • value  981000
    address  18u7rSRVRxauq5HjwFpG3i9WcJvWRTcj6N
  • 71578aaf90af8b4e17e115a943ff0e390a29d076da201cffd03b68d3e021fc41:1
  • value  110194810
    address  1FAQP3MwG7nGKaNMpXKSNWLMkjbqwoSKef